Sleep-mode:
Activation: automatically
When Aladin
®
Air Z O
2
is not used, it is in the sleep-mode.
The display does not show any information. The computer is briefly activated
once every minute to measure atmospheric pressure. The display remains
switched off. If a change in altitude is recognized, Aladin
®
Air Z O
2
switches to
—>surface-mode for 3 minutes and afterwards back to the surface-sleep-
mode. The increasing of the pressure from descending, automatically activates
the dive-mode.
Ready-mode:
Activation: By touching contacts B and E from sleep-mode.
To check the display, all signs light up for 5 seconds
After activation the Aladin
®
Air Z O
2
switches into ready-mode. Once in ready-
mode, the display is switched on and the set portion of oxygen is shown. In cer-
tain circumstances altitude sections are also displayed. If the pressure transmit-
ter or Oxy2 is switched on and located within transmitting distance, either the
tank-pressure or the oxygen fraction is displayed, otherwise <---> will be dis-
played.
By touching contacts B and E in the ready-mode once more, Aladin
®
Air Z O
2
will display its remaining battery life by percentage. Three minutes after activa-
ting the ready-mode, Aladin
®
Air Z O
2
will fall back into the —>sleep-mode.
